KINGSVILLE KINGS FALL TO LONDON LAKERS

Down 5-1, the Kingsville Kings rallied back but it was too little, too late as they fell to the visiting London Lakers 6-5 Sunday afternoon.

Facing their rivals, the Kings saw their Greater Metrol Junior ‘A’ Hockey League record slip to 27-7-0-5.

Matyas Kasek had one of his best games of the season for the Kings, notching a pair of tallies including his 20th of the season. Also scoring for Kingsville were Brendan MacKenzie, Dan Leach and Thomas McKinnon.

With the post-season looming on the horizon, the Kings have just five games left in the regular season. Upcoming, they travel to Niagara to take on the Whalers on Thursday, are at St. George on Friday and Sunday play host to Tillsonburg at 3 p.m.
